WebJOHN HIGLEY John Higley, son of Jonathan and Katherine (Brewster) Higley, was born on July 22, 1649 in Frimley (Surrey), England, and worked as a glove maker’s apprentice. He left England in 1665 and settled in Windsor where he was indentured to John Drake, a prosperous merchant and later father-in-law to Higley.
WebSurname meaning for HIGLEY. English: habitational name from Highley (Shropshire) recorded as Hugelei in 1086 from an Old English personal name Hugga + Old English lēah ‘woodland clearing’. The modern form Highley is probably due to folk etymology (see Highley) . . .
